# Subscriber Update

> Update an existing subscriber's name, gender, or labels via the ChatSyncs API. Use when a developer asks how to keep subscriber profile data in sync with their own CRM.

Updates fields on an existing subscriber.

<Note>
  By REST convention this would ideally be a `PUT` request — but the ChatSyncs API only exposes
  it as `POST`. Use POST as shown below.
</Note>

<Tip>
  **Where to find a label's ID:** open **Subscriber Manager → Manage → Manage Labels** — the ID
  is shown next to each label name, ready to copy. Or call
  [Label List](/developer-api/label/list-labels) to fetch all of them at once. See
  [Finding Your IDs & API Token](/developer-api/finding-ids#label-id-label_id) for a screenshot.
</Tip>


## OpenAPI

````yaml POST /whatsapp/subscriber/update
openapi: 3.1.0
info:
  title: ChatSyncs Developer API
  version: 1.0.0
  description: >-
    REST API for sending WhatsApp messages and managing subscribers through
    ChatSyncs.
servers:
  - url: https://platform.chatsyncs.com/api/v1
security: []
paths:
  /whatsapp/subscriber/update:
    post:
      tags:
        - Subscriber API
      summary: Subscriber Update
      operationId: updateSubscriber
      requestBody:
        required: true
        content:
          application/x-www-form-urlencoded:
            schema:
              type: object
              properties:
                apiToken:
                  type: string
                  description: >-
                    Your ChatSyncs API key (not a WhatsApp/Meta access token).
                    [Where to find
                    it](/developer-api/finding-ids#api-token-apitoken).
                  example: API-KEY
                phone_number_id:
                  type: string
                  description: >-
                    The WhatsApp account's phone number ID. [Where to find
                    it](/developer-api/finding-ids#phone-number-id-phone_number_id).
                  example: PHONE-NUMBER-ID
                phone_number:
                  type: string
                  description: >-
                    The subscriber's phone number, with country code, digits
                    only.
                  example: PHONE-NUMBER
                first_name:
                  type: string
                  description: The subscriber's first name.
                last_name:
                  type: string
                  description: The subscriber's last name.
                gender:
                  type: string
                  description: The subscriber's gender.
                label_ids:
                  type: string
                  description: >-
                    Comma-separated label IDs, e.g. 1,4,5. [Where to find
                    it](/developer-api/finding-ids#label-id-label_id).
              required:
                - apiToken
                - phone_number_id
                - phone_number
      responses:
        '200':
          description: >-
            Standard ChatSyncs response. `status` is `"1"` on success and `"0"`
            on failure.
          content:
            application/json:
              schema:
                type: object
                properties:
                  status:
                    type: string
                    description: '`"1"` = success, `"0"` = failure.'
                  message:
                    type: string
                    description: Human-readable result message.
              examples:
                success:
                  summary: Success
                  value:
                    status: '1'
                    message: Subscriber updated successfully.
                error:
                  summary: Error
                  value:
                    status: '0'
                    message: Invalid request.

````
